Landscape

These two paintings explore the emotional resonance of natural spaces through abstraction and color. One features undulating blue dunes beneath a fiery sky, where mountain silhouettes rise against a dramatic sunset. The other presents a serene expanse of sky and earth, with soft gradients and textured terrain evoking quiet distance and open possibility. Both compositions use expressive brushwork and layered hues to suggest movement, transition, and the beauty of the unseen. Together, they offer a contemplative journey through imagined horizons.

  • Medium: Oil on canvas

  • Size: 24 x 24 inches

  • Year: 2023

Sacred Geometry — Architecture of Color and Form

This duo of geometric abstractions invites viewers into a contemplative space where color and structure converge. Interlocking shapes and bold palettes—reds, blacks, creams, and golds—create a sense of architectural rhythm and spatial illusion. Each composition plays with depth and perspective, resembling cityscapes or sacred constructions built from light and shadow. The sharp angles and layered textures evoke both modern design and timeless symbolism, offering a visual meditation on balance, order, and the beauty of form.

  • Medium: Oil on canvas

  • Size: 24 x 24 inches

  • Year: 2025

Journey into Light — A Sailboat at Sunset

This expressive painting captures a sailboat gliding through golden waters beneath a radiant sunset. Bold brushstrokes and warm hues—yellows, reds, and oranges—illuminate the sky and ripple across the waves, evoking movement, reflection, and hope. The lone vessel sails toward the horizon, framed by distant mountains and a glowing sun, suggesting a spiritual voyage or a moment of quiet courage. Rich in texture and emotion, the scene invites viewers to contemplate the beauty of transition and the promise carried by light.

  • Medium: Oil on canvas

  • Size: 24 x 30 inches

  • Year: 2025

Rivers of Wonder — Waterfalls Between Worlds

These two paintings explore the mystery and majesty of waterfalls as portals between realms—natural, urban, and divine. One piece cascades from golden towers into a river winding through jewel-toned hills, merging cityscape and landscape in a surreal dance of color and texture. The other reveals a more meditative scene: a golden sun watches over a quiet waterfall framed by bare branches, glittering foliage, and abstract rain. Both compositions use metallic accents, layered brushwork, and symbolic forms to evoke movement, reflection, and transcendence. Together, they invite viewers to contemplate the flow of life and the beauty found at the meeting point of creation and imagination.

  • Medium: Mix Media

  • Size: 30 x 48 inches
